Raquel, you will need to link your party through your
My Disney Experience account to their theme park tickets. You will need to make sure your family is connected through the
Family & Friends list and have given each other permission to share all plans before linking your tickets.
Once you have done this, you’re ready to link your tickets! Hover over the My Disney Experience logo on the top right of the
Walt Disney World Resort website, and you will want to click on “My Plans.” Select “Park Tickets,” and this will allow you to select your tickets and link them. It will also allow you to then choose from your Family & Friends list to who you would like to assign your tickets to.
If you have trouble with any of this, do not hesitate to give
Existing Tickets a call, and a Cast Member will be happy to assist you!
